The mathematical foundations varies from simple addition to calculus .
For example , addition of signals using summer circuit which may be an operational amplifiers involves rule of simple addition or substraction of input signals to feed it forward to other block or actuator .
We can find multiplier that does multiplication to provide gain signal of desired value to a particular block .
Also Integrators and differentiators using operational amplifiers are used to realize or make up the various transfer functions that runs the control system . These are basically simple form of calculus application .
